"A real supercar with realistic running costs"

What things have gone wrong with the car?

Windscreen wiper switch.

Alternator replaced.

Engine temperature sensor (for cold start)

Electrical earthing problems.

Turbo hoses replaced.

Clutch on its way out...

General comments?

Fantastic performance and very refined drive. Wonderful handling although requires respect in the wet.

Exotic, rare and benefits from specialist attention - in my case by PJ Autos. The GTA definitely prefers regular use rather than once a month!

Problems in sourcing original size rear tyres have forced me to join many others in replacing the factory alloy wheels with bigger ones for which tyres can be easily obtained.

New rear tyres can be sourced from Michelin, but they are rather costly; £220 each. I think two suppliers in the UK can get them, one near london and and one in south yorks. The club webiste might be able to help.
